Transmission control apparatus for an automatic transmission
Abstract
The improved CVT control apparatus for a vehicle is disclosed. By using the CVT control apparatus, it becomes possible that the drive feeling is constant independently of a running state, the vehicle is accelerated as the driver's intention if accelerated due to the actuation of an accelerator pedal, and the run of the vehicle is performed so as to improve the fuel consumption rate if the acceleration is not required. By always calculating a correct driving torque, the transmission gear ratio is calculated to obtain the target driving torque set based on the amount of actuation of an accelerator pedal, and the obtained target driving torque is corrected by the gradient of a road obtained from the calculated driving torque. Further, the gear ratio which aims at the improvement of acceleration and the gear ratio which aims at the improvement of the rate of fuel consumption are weighted and combined with each other, and the optimum gear ratio is obtained by using fuzzy inference.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A control apparatus for an automatic transmission of a vehicle including a gear ratio calculating unit for controlling the automatic transmission to transfer an output of an engine of the vehicle to driven wheels after changing the gear ratio, and calculating the gear ratio, and a speed-change control unit for controlling the gear ratio based on the result of the calculation, comprising:
a target driving torque generating unit for generating a value of the target driving torque based on a adaptation coefficient indicative of a running state and a vehicle speed, a driving torque calculating unit for calculating a value of driving torque based on the adaptation coefficient, the vehicle speed and the engine speed, a correcting unit for obtaining a correcting value for correcting the value of the target driving torque based on the value of the driving torque calculated by said driving torque calculating unit and correcting the target driving torque, a gear-ratio-change-command unit for generating a gear-ratio-change-command based on the correction value obtained by said correcting means and commanding the change in the gear ratio, wherein said speed-change control unit changes the gear ratio based on the gear-ratio-change-command from the gear-ratio-change-command unit.
2 . A control apparatus for an automatic transmission of a vehicle according to claim 1 , wherein the value of the target driving torque is determined due to the characteristics of the target driving torque predetermined based on the adaptation coefficient and the vehicle speed.
3 . A control apparatus for an automatic transmission of a vehicle according to claim 1 , wherein the adaptation coefficient is throttle opening of a throttle valve for controlling the amount of air taken into the engine of the vehicle.
